If you are looking for a small and lightweight smartwatch that will look better on your wrist than a sporty fitness band, Samsung has got something for you: the brand new Galaxy Watch Active.
Priced at the quite affordable $200, the Galaxy Watch Active works with both Android phones and iPhones, it is half the price of an Apple Watch and also much less expensive than Samsung’s other Gear watches, while still offering a beautiful display, a metal body, as well as a heart-rate monitor, GPS, workout and sleep tracking.
Samsung has even promised that this watch will be its first one that you will be able to use to measure your blood pressure (but that feature is coming later on and is not available at launch).

Samsung Galaxy Watch Active Review Specs:
1.1-inch 360 x 360px AMOLED screen (40mm watch size),
Gorilla Glass 3 Dual-core Exynos 9110 processor 768MB RAM,
4GB storage
230mAh battery Tizen OS 4 IP68,
MIL-STD-810G certified,
5ATM water resistance
Wireless charging support Bluetooth 4.2,
Wi-Fi b/g/n,
NFC (but no MST) and A-GPS
4 colors: Silver, Black, Rose Gold and Sea Green
Price $200 / 250 euro
